Linda (Linda) subatricornis n. sp is described from Sichuan (holotype locality), Fujian, Shaanxi, Hebei, Ningxia of China. It is separated from the most similar species L. atricornis Pic by differences in genitalia and antennal insertions. Detailed descriptions, photographs of habitus and genitalia, distribution of the two sibling species and short discussion on the related species are presented
